LG X820 PC is book-sized
Posted on Jun 7, 07 10:09 PM PDT

LG updates the Lluon series of desktops at Computex 2007 by introducing the X820. This mini desktop will use Intel's latest Series 3 chipset that manages to reduce power consumption without sacrificing speed. Features include an Intel Core 2 Duo 2.13GHz processor with 4MB level 2 cache, a mid-range video card, a DVD rewriter, 1GB of RAM, a 0.5TB hard drive, and Windows Vista Home Premium as the operating system of choice. The LG X820 will retail in Korea for $1,392. I like the minimalist case that makes the X820 fit into any modern living room comfortably.
